Output 976341624ea5397a74d4225fd7530c224f34a649ab2dbba7383c7691f71d27d9:25

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57b066d6de0f615fe82cb46677a84153459974c OP_EQUAL
address
3NcQ3QaAdSRdoFi9WMa5aYafhR3wtW4bUb
transaction
976341624ea5397a74d4225fd7530c224f34a649ab2dbba7383c7691f71d27d9
spent
true